Waterjet Abrasive Cutting System - DLA Weapon Support ( Richmond) intends to issue a request for quote ( RFQ) in accordance with FAR 13. 5. Description of requirements: Waterjet cutting system in accordance with Technical Specification VIBB 26- 35- **** per
miscellaneous machine tools
AI helper
This is a solicitation notice for a waterjet cutting system in accordance with technical specification VIBB 26 35 1001. The performance period is 180 days after receipt of order. Delivery is FOB destination to Warner Robins Air Logistics Complex, Warner Robins, GA ****, with inspection at origin and acceptance at destination. The solicitation will be issued on or around May 22, 2026, and will be available on the DLA DIBBS website. Registration in SAM. gov is required for all respondents. Proposals must be submitted by the closing date and time listed in the solicitation. The award decision may be based on a combination of LPTA, past performance, and other evaluation factors.
